Dental HygienistWaupaca, Wisconsin
We’re hiring a Dental Hygienist who wants schedule flexibility, strong benefits, and the opportunity to make a meaningful impact in a collaborative community health setting.
You’ll step into an outpatient clinical role focused on preventive dental hygiene care, patient education, and coordination with a full oral health team. This position offers one-hour appointments, balanced patient volumes, and the ability to choose your own schedule within a supportive Federally Qualified Health Center environment.
You’ll practice in Waupaca, Wisconsin, a scenic lakeside community surrounded by forests and natural beauty, offering a peaceful lifestyle and close-knit community atmosphere while making a significant impact on patient access to care.
Why this role is compelling• Full-time 4-day work week with Fridays off• Hygienists choose their own schedules• One-hour appointments for all patients• Balanced patient population of adults and children ages 4 and older• Mission-driven Federally Qualified Health Center setting• Dentrix EMR system• Strong loan repayment eligibility and comprehensive benefits
What makes you a great fit• You are a licensed Dental Hygienist in the State of Wisconsin• You enjoy preventive care and patient education• You value team-based, patient-centered care• You are comfortable treating both pediatric and adult populations• New graduates are welcome• You are authorized to work in the United States
Compensation & Benefits• Hourly pay: $40 per hour for entry-level up to $46 per hour based on experience• Health insurance: 70 percent employer paid plus 75 percent of out-of-pocket costs covered• Dental and vision insurance approximately $194 annually• Paid time off: 3 weeks PTO in year one plus 7 paid holidays including 1 floating holiday• CME allowance: $500 annually• Retirement: 403(b) and IRA with 4 percent employer match, fully vested after 4 years• Life insurance: $100,000 employer provided• Short-term and long-term disability 100 percent employer paid• Relocation assistance: $3,000 for out-of-state hires• Student loan repayment eligibility: NHSC up to $50,000 and Wisconsin Office of Rural Health up to $25,000• Malpractice coverage through FTCA• Optional AFLAC benefits and pet insurance
